The widespread use of humidity generators extends beyond conventional domains, supported by a variety of growth factors. Apart from their well-established functions in greenhouses and labs, the growing focus on indoor air quality in industries including healthcare, museums, and data centers is driving demand. Companies such as Honeywell International Inc. have made significant strides in the humidification market by introducing solutions specifically designed for healthcare environments with the goal of reducing the spread of airborne diseases.
Furthermore, a new era of prospects for humidity control systems has been brought about by the development of smart homes and buildings. Companies like Aprilaire have led the way in developing innovations like smart humidifiers, which easily interface with current smart home ecosystems to enable remote monitoring and automated adjustments based on current circumstances. This increases user convenience and productivity.
Developments in technology are yet another engine driving the market. The development of ultrasonic humidifiers, which create a thin mist by using high-frequency sound waves, embodies the need for improved effectiveness and user experience. Businesses such as Midea Group are leading the way in R&D projects meant to use ultrasonic technology to improve the efficiency and longevity of their product lines.
In the context of increased environmental awareness, sustainability has been a key focus in the market for humidity generators.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on designing energy-efficient models that minimize power usage without compromising performance, matching with the expanding need for eco-friendly solutions across industries. Simultaneously, water-saving technologies—such as the introduction of evaporative humidifiers—are becoming more popular, especially in areas where there are worries about water scarcity. Prominent initiatives by businesses such as Stadler Form highlight a dedication to developing cutting-edge evaporative humidifiers that optimize humidification capacity while reducing water use.
